Abstract

The legal framework for courses, social integration programmes for foreign citizens consists of a series of normative acts representing primary legislation and respectively, secondary legislation. Romania has been having a legislation in the field of integration since 2004. Certain ministries and the local authorities are the main attributions in this area. The legislation is in the process of changing. We try to adapt to the existing situation, to the new needs, to the new requirements at European level. In this respect, it is likely that the legislation will undergo some changes in the near future. In Romania, each institutional actor (The Ministry of Home Affairs, The Ministry of National Education, The Ministry of Labour and Social Justice, The Ministry of Health, etc.) is responsible for integrating non-nationals in its field of activity, coordinating and monitoring the policy of the Ministry of Home Affairs through the General Inspectorate for Immigration (GII), which also has the task of providing, through its regional structures, specific services to facilitate the integration into the Romanian society of different categories of foreigners. Institutional coordination is mainly done through meetings with decision makers (organised according to the National Immigration Strategy) and expert meetings (regularly organised by the General Inspectorate for Immigration through the Asylum and Integration Directorate). According to the GII data, the number of non-nationals in Romania fluctuated slightly between 2007 and 2017, standing at about 100,000, of which about 40,000 are EU citizens. At 31.12.2016 there were 112,144 non-nationals in Romania, of which 58% were from third countries and 42% from EU and EEA countries. Aims of the courses The objective of the Romanian language learning course is to provide an elementary level of language that facilitates integration into the Romanian society. The objectives of the cultural accommodation sessions are: to initiate and facilitate the integration process in Romania; to provide a more accurate picture of the realities in Romania; to raise awareness.
